{"data":{"id":"us/46-cfr-45.151","jurisdiction":"us","citation":"46 CFR 45.151","heading":"Other openings.","body":"Each opening other than hatchways, machinery space openings, manholes, or flush scuttles—\n(a) In freeboard decks, must be protected by an enclosed superstructure or by a deckhouse or companionway that is equal in strength and weathertightness to an enclosed superstructure; or\n(b) In exposed superstructure decks or in the top of a deckhouse on freeboard decks that gives access to a space below the freeboard deck or a space within an enclosed superstructure, must be protected by a deckhouse or companionway.","path":["Title 46—Shipping","CHAPTER I—COAST GUARD, DEPARTMENT OF HOMELAND SECURITY","SUBCHAPTER E—LOAD LINES","PART 45—GREAT LAKES LOAD LINES","Subpart D—Conditions of Assignment"],"source_url":"https://www.ecfr.gov/api/versioner/v1/full/2026-08-25/title-46.xml","current_through":"2026-08-25","vintage":"","retrieved_at":"2026-08-27T02:26:22Z","sha256":"ad3b91ae06bb065251c0fcc6b2ee98f2e54ed8cf845f982615251465c0e52740","source_id":"us-cfr","stale":true,"prev":"us/46-cfr-45.149","next":"us/46-cfr-45.153"},"notice":"GroundRules: Original legal text.
